**Handover: bulk edits in the Ordwell admin table**

Bulk edit now supports up to 500 rows per operation; anything larger gets chunked server-side. Undo works per chunk, not per batch — worth flagging in the release notes. Permissions gating shipped last sprint and is stable. Remaining known issues and the rollout checklist are tracked on the internal page here.

operations page: https://jira.zemvarlabs.internal/browse/pages/pages/projects

Runbook: Fleet fuel-usage report generation (Tarncastle Logistics). The nightly job aggregates pump logs, applies vehicle-class normalization, and writes a signed CSV to the reporting bucket. Access is restricted to the reporting role; no raw odometer data leaves the enclave. For review purposes, the job runs with the configuration shown below.

service settings:
[silwyn]
host = silwyn.crelvogrid.internal
user = silwyn_svc
database = silwyn_prod

## Local Setup: Role-Based Access

The Fennelwick wiki enforces three roles—reader, editor, and steward—resolved at login against the permissions table. For the weekly eng sync demo, run the seed script first so the steward role exists locally; otherwise page-edit routes return 403. Role caching lasts five minutes, so changes may lag. The permissions service needs direct access to the local roles database before the app boots. Use the following connection string to point it there.

primary connection of yagep-kahip = redis://giliel_svc:zYiKsLL2PLpfPL@db-348f.xolmarsys.corp:5432/fenwyn

### Gateway Buffering

The Furrowlink gateway collects telemetry from field equipment over an intermittent LTE uplink, so all design choices assume frequent disconnects. Readings are written to a ring buffer on local flash and flushed opportunistically when the link returns. Flush batch size trades radio time against data freshness; the defaults were chosen after two harvest seasons of logs from the Dennick trial farms. Maintainers should adjust only the constants listed here:

tuning table, faduf-baduf:
PRIORITIES = {
    "ulavan": 191,
    "silys": 750,
    "goriel": 238,
    "kelmir": 66,
    "wendor": 432,
}